Bug 461227

Summary: KDE Connect crash when click on virtual monitor button
Product: [Applications] kdeconnect Reporter: Steven <steven.chenmy>
Component: commonAssignee: Albert Vaca Cintora <albertvaka>
Status: RESOLVED WORKSFORME    
Severity: crash CC: aleixpol, nicolas.fella
Priority: NOR Keywords: drkonqi
Version First Reported In: 22.08.1   
Target Milestone: ---   
Platform: Fedora RPMs   
OS: Linux   
Latest Commit: Version Fixed/Implemented In:
Sentry Crash Report:

Description Steven 2022-10-31 02:23:28 UTC
Application: kdeconnectd (22.08.1)

Qt Version: 5.15.6
Frameworks Version: 5.99.0
Operating System: Linux 6.0.5-200.fc36.x86_64 x86_64
Windowing System: X11
Distribution: Fedora Linux 36 (KDE Plasma)
DrKonqi: 5.25.5 [KCrashBackend]

-- Information about the crash:
fir time seems to work, second time sometime crash. repeated clicking is guaranteed to crash.
the other side is a windows 11 pc with no vnc installed so when it work there is a pop-up ask me which app to open vnc link.

The crash can be reproduced sometimes.

-- Backtrace:
Application: KDE Connect 守护进程 (kdeconnectd), signal: Segmentation fault

[KCrash Handler]
#4  0x0000000000000020 in ?? ()
#5  0x00007fa52c6da063 in VirtualMonitorPlugin::stop() () from /usr/lib64/qt5/plugins/kdeconnect/kdeconnect_virtualmonitor.so
#6  0x00007fa52c6dc520 in VirtualMonitorPlugin::requestVirtualMonitor() () from /usr/lib64/qt5/plugins/kdeconnect/kdeconnect_virtualmonitor.so
#7  0x00007fa52c6dd930 in VirtualMonitorPlugin::qt_metacall(QMetaObject::Call, int, void**) () from /usr/lib64/qt5/plugins/kdeconnect/kdeconnect_virtualmonitor.so
#8  0x00007fa5413920bb in QDBusConnectionPrivate::deliverCall(QObject*, int, QDBusMessage const&, QVector<int> const&, int) () from /lib64/libQt5DBus.so.5
#9  0x00007fa541395f66 in QDBusConnectionPrivate::activateCall(QObject*, int, QDBusMessage const&) [clone .part.0] () from /lib64/libQt5DBus.so.5
#10 0x00007fa54139653e in QDBusConnectionPrivate::activateObject(QDBusConnectionPrivate::ObjectTreeNode&, QDBusMessage const&, int) () from /lib64/libQt5DBus.so.5
#11 0x00007fa541398a0c in QDBusActivateObjectEvent::placeMetaCall(QObject*) () from /lib64/libQt5DBus.so.5
#12 0x00007fa5408d2c44 in QObject::event(QEvent*) () from /lib64/libQt5Core.so.5
#13 0x00007fa5415aed02 in QApplicationPrivate::notify_helper(QObject*, QEvent*) () from /lib64/libQt5Widgets.so.5
#14 0x00007fa5408a81c8 in QCoreApplication::notifyInternal2(QObject*, QEvent*) () from /lib64/libQt5Core.so.5
#15 0x00007fa5408ab534 in QCoreApplicationPrivate::sendPostedEvents(QObject*, int, QThreadData*) () from /lib64/libQt5Core.so.5
#16 0x00007fa5408f9537 in postEventSourceDispatch(_GSource*, int (*)(void*), void*) () from /lib64/libQt5Core.so.5
#17 0x00007fa53ede5faf in g_main_context_dispatch () from /lib64/libglib-2.0.so.0
#18 0x00007fa53ee3b2c8 in g_main_context_iterate.constprop () from /lib64/libglib-2.0.so.0
#19 0x00007fa53ede3940 in g_main_context_iteration () from /lib64/libglib-2.0.so.0
#20 0x00007fa5408f902a in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/lib64/libQt5Core.so.5
#21 0x00007fa5408a6c1a in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from /lib64/libQt5Core.so.5
#22 0x00007fa5408aece2 in QCoreApplication::exec() () from /lib64/libQt5Core.so.5
#23 0x000055d747022106 in main ()
[Inferior 1 (process 13725) detached]

Reported using DrKonqi
Comment 1 Aleix Pol 2022-10-31 12:22:26 UTC
Would you be able to provide a backtrace that we can use?

Here is some explanation on how to do so.
https://community.kde.org/Guidelines_and_HOWTOs/Debugging/How_to_create_useful_crash_reports
Comment 2 Bug Janitor Service 2022-11-15 05:15:45 UTC
Dear Bug Submitter,

This bug has been in NEEDSINFO status with no change for at least
15 days. Please provide the requested information as soon as
possible and set the bug status as REPORTED. Due to regular bug
tracker maintenance, if the bug is still in NEEDSINFO status with
no change in 30 days the bug will be closed as RESOLVED > WORKSFORME
due to lack of needed information.

For more information about our bug triaging procedures please read the
wiki located here:
https://community.kde.org/Guidelines_and_HOWTOs/Bug_triaging

If you have already provided the requested information, please
mark the bug as REPORTED so that the KDE team knows that the bug is
ready to be confirmed.

Thank you for helping us make KDE software even better for everyone!
Comment 3 Bug Janitor Service 2022-11-30 05:17:13 UTC
This bug has been in NEEDSINFO status with no change for at least
30 days. The bug is now closed as RESOLVED > WORKSFORME
due to lack of needed information.

For more information about our bug triaging procedures please read the
wiki located here:
https://community.kde.org/Guidelines_and_HOWTOs/Bug_triaging

Thank you for helping us make KDE software even better for everyone!